如何更改键入部分命令时显示的建议?

时间:2018-01-05 15:01:42

标签: visual-studio intellisense

我在Visual Studio中做了很多JavaScript,我经常输入字母cl然后会弹出一个弹出窗口。在那个popup" console.log"会突出显示,我会点击标签,它会将该命令放在我的编辑器中。

然而,当我输入单词" class"突出显示。我不知道发生了什么,但是如何让它重新显示/突出显示console.log?

感谢。

1 个答案:

答案 0 :(得分:1)

检查您的代码片段管理器(工具>代码片段管理器...)

在JavaScript语言下,您应该会看到您使用的cl代码段。

enter image description here

如果您需要重新创建代码段文件,请使用此内容在代码段位置创建新的cl.snippet文件,然后从代码段管理器中添加该文件。

<CodeSnippet Format="1.1.0" xmlns="http://schemas.microsoft.com/VisualStudio/2005/CodeSnippet">
  <Header>
    <Title>cl</Title>
    <Author>Microsoft Corporation</Author>
    <Shortcut>cl</Shortcut>
    <Description>Code snippet for console.log</Description>
    <SnippetTypes>
      <SnippetType>Expansion</SnippetType>
    </SnippetTypes>
  </Header>
  <Snippet>
    <Code Language="JavaScript"><![CDATA[console.log($end$);]]></Code>
  </Snippet>
</CodeSnippet>

修改

要让您的console.log()功能在.html和.cshtml文件中运行,请创建一个新的代码段文件,如上所述,但将代码语言从JavaScript更改为HTML。将文件保存在My HTML Snippets文件位置。

(要找到它,请在Code Snippets Manager中选择语言:HTML,然后突出显示我的HTML代码段。显示位置。对我而言,它是C:\ Users {user.name} \ Documents \ Visual Studio 2017 \ Code Snippets \ Visual Web Developer \ My HTML Snippets。)

现在输入 C L Tab 应该填充console.log();